git: Don't consider $HOME as containing git repository unless it's opened directly (#25948)

When a worktree is created, we walk up the ancestors of the root path
trying to find a git repository. In particular, if your `$HOME` is a git
repository and you open some subdirectory of `$HOME` that's *not* a git
repository, we end up scanning `$HOME` and everything under it looking
for changed and untracked files, which is often pretty slow. Consistency
here is not very useful and leads to a bad experience.

This PR adds a special case to not consider `$HOME` as a containing git
repository, unless you ask for it by doing the equivalent of `zed ~`.

Release Notes:

- Changed the behavior of git features to not treat `$HOME` as a git
repository unless opened directly
